Ṭāhā: 36

"He said: 'You have been granted...'"

The Request (al-su’ūl): It means that which is requested (al-maṭlūb). It is a noun in the form of a faʿl (فعل) used in the sense of a mafʿūl (مفعول), similar to your saying khubz (خبز) meaning makhbūz (baked), and akl (أكل) meaning ma’kūl (eaten).
